Figure Out Transportation
Bangkok’s maze of bustling streets can be confusing but easy to navigate once you figure out your transportation. Familiarise yourself with the city’s MRT subway and BTS Skytrain systems. You can also rely on your hotel for taxis, or use local ride-hailing apps like Grab.
Understand Business Culture
Thailand’s business culture is based on humility, respect and politeness. Try to avoid aggressive negotiating and prioritise a patient approach during discussions. Make sure to wear modest clothing for meetings and hand out business cards which are considered important when meeting colleagues for the first time.
